Torex Gold completes acquisition of Prime Mining

TXG · Price
Executive Summary
- Torex Gold Resources Inc. has completed its previously announced plan of arrangement to acquire all issued and outstanding common shares of Prime Mining Corp.
- The acquisition adds the advanced-stage Los Reyes development project in Sinaloa, Mexico, to Torex’s portfolio, complementing recent acquisitions including Reyna Silver.
- Former Prime Mining shareholders receive 0.06 Torex common shares for each Prime Mining share, resulting in them owning approximately 10.6% of Torex on a non-diluted basis.
Key Details
- Transaction Structure: Plan of arrangement to acquire 100% of Prime Mining Corp.
- Consideration: 0.06 Torex common shares for each Prime Mining common share exchanged.
- Aggregate Shares Issued: Approximately 10.2 million Torex shares.
- Post-Transaction Ownership: Former Prime Mining shareholders own approximately 10.6% of Torex’s issued and outstanding shares (non-diluted basis).
- Asset Acquired: Los Reyes development project in Sinaloa, Mexico (high-grade gold and silver deposit).
- Mineral Resources (Los Reyes):
- Indicated: 49.0 million tonnes containing 1,491,000 oz Au (0.95 g/t) and 54.00 million oz Ag (34.2 g/t).
- Inferred: 17.2 million tonnes containing 538,000 oz Au (0.97 g/t) and 21.56 million oz Ag (39.0 g/t).
- Effective Date: October 15, 2024.
- Strategic Context: Los Reyes complements Torex’s existing assets in Nevada (Gryphon, Medicine Springs) and Chihuahua (Batopilas, Guigui, Reyna Silver), supporting the goal of becoming a diversified, Americas-focused precious metals producer.
- Future Plans: Team focused on smooth transition and delivering a preliminary economic assessment (PEA) on Los Reyes by mid-2026.
- Delisting: Prime Mining shares expected to delist from TSX, OTCQX, and Frankfurt Stock Exchange within 2-3 business days.

Notable Quotes
- Jody Kuzenko, President and CEO of Torex: "We have now concluded our acquisition of Prime Mining, which adds the advanced stage Los Reyes development project in Sinaloa, Mexico, to our portfolio of assets -- a highly prospective, high-grade gold and silver deposit."
- Jody Kuzenko: "Since announcing the transaction, our team has been focused on ensuring a smooth transition in order to leverage the excellent work completed by the Prime Mining team and set the foundation for delivering a preliminary economic assessment on Los Reyes by mid-2026."
- Jody Kuzenko: "Los Reyes complements the suite of assets in Nevada, USA, and Chihuahua, Mexico, that were added to our portfolio earlier this year through the acquisition of Reyna Silver. Together, these acquisitions support our goal of becoming a diversified, Americas-focused, precious metals producer..."
